Beef and Biscuit

Yield : 10 servings
Ingredients
-
1 ¼ pounds lean ground beef½ cup chopped onion¼ cup chopped green chile pepper1 (8 ounce) can tomato sauce2 teaspoons chili powder½ teaspoon garlic salt1 (10 ounce) can refrigerated buttermilk biscuit dough1 ½ cups shredded Monterey Jack cheese, divided½ cup sour cream1 egg, lightly beaten
Directions
-
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).In a large skillet, brown the ground beef, onion and green chile pepper; drain. Stir in tomato sauce, chili powder ,and garlic salt. Simmer while preparing the biscuits.Separate biscuit dough into 10 biscuits. Pull each biscuit into 2 layers. Press 10 biscuit halves on the bottom of a 9-inch pie dish to form bottom crust. Reserve the other 10 biscuit halves for the top layer.Remove meat mixture from heat, and stir in 1/2 cup shredded cheese, sour cream, and egg; mix well. Spoon over bottom crust. Arrange remaining biscuit halves to form top crust, and spoon remaining cheese evenly over the top.Bake in preheated oven for 25 to 30 minutes, or until biscuits are a deep golden brown color.
